Dr. Mehran Turna is a Researcher at the Institute of Neuroscience and Medicine (INM-7: Brain and Behavior) within the Research Center Jülich, Germany. His work focuses on developing digital biomarker platforms and sensor-based technologies for remote monitoring of neurological and psychiatric conditions. Key contributions include the JTrack platform, which enables ecological momentary assessment and behavioral tracking in clinical settings. His research addresses Parkinson’s disease, autism spectrum disorder, and neuropsychiatric disease progression through wearable sensors and smartphone-based diagnostics.
His academic background includes early contributions to fMRI-based brain activity classification (2013–2014) and a transition to digital health solutions since 2020. He collaborates on open-source neuro-medicine software infrastructure and evaluates sensor systems for gait analysis and home-based rehabilitation. Dr. Turna’s work bridges clinical neuroscience with telemedicine innovations, emphasizing cross-platform applications and data reliability in remote patient monitoring.
